Kurzy a certifikace Open Source

Cloud

Elasticsearch: ukládání, vyhledávání a vizualizace dat

12.500 CZK

Cena (bez DPH)

Days1

Kurz je určen pro všechny, kdo se chtějí naučit, jak pomocí Elasticsearch ukládat a vyhledávat ve velkém množství dat, která lze jednoduše škálovat – ať už stavíte fulltextové vyhledávání, ukládáte a vyhodnocujete logy, nebo chcete mít přístup k důležitým datům businessu na jednom místě.
Po absolvování budete rozumět principům Elasticsearch a budete ho schopni použít pro konkrétní požadavky v praxi. Výuka je vedená blokově: nejdřív porozumění oblasti, hned potom krátké ověření/lab, a k okruhům dostanete materiály pro pozdější osvěžení.

Cílová skupina:

IT profesionálové, kteří potřebují řešit ukládání většího množství dat, chtějí v nich jednoduše vyhledávat a data vizualizovat.

Cíle kurzu:

Účastníci se mimo jiné naučí:

  • Orientovat se v architektuře ELK a pochopit, k čemu Elasticsearch typicky slouží.
  • Rozlišit Elastic vs OpenSearch a porozumět praktickým dopadům do nasazení a provozu.
  • Navrhnout základní podobu clusteru: node roles, shardy, repliky, data tiers a jejich vliv na výkon a dostupnost.
  • Zvládnout základy ukládání dat, indexace a mapování a vědět, na co si dát pozor v praxi.
  • Používat Query DSL pro běžné vyhledávací scénáře (query/filter, bool, kombinace podmínek).
  • Prakticky nasadit cluster z připravené konfigurace a ověřit základní funkčnost.
  • Pochopit základy sběru dat (agent, ingest pipelines, ECS) a základní práci v Kibaně (Discover/Lens/Dashboardy).
  • Odnést si principy pro horizontální škálování a práci s velkým objemem dat.

Osnova:

  • Úvod
    • Krátce historie
    • Elastic vs OpenSearch
  • Základy
    • Cluster a node roles
    • Shardy, repliky, data tiers
    • ILM
  • Indexování, mapování
    • Vyhledávání s použitím Query DSL
  • Cvičení
    • Nasazení clusteru z připravené konfigurace (hands-on)
  • Sběr logů a dat
    • Elastic Agent + Fleet
    • Ingest pipelines
    • ECS
  • Kibana a tipy do praxe
    • Discover, Lens, Dashboardy
    • Monitoring
    • Bezpečnost

Technické specifikace:

  • Počítač s jakýmkoliv OS (Linux, Windows, OS X)
  • SSH klient a oprávnění připojit se vzdáleně na SSH 
  • Webový prohlížeč

Předpoklady účastníka:

Základní znalost databázových systémů.

 

Poptejte kurz u nás

Kurzy
Submit
* Povinné pole